#c03e30 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c03e30 is composed of 75.3% red, 24.3% green and 18.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 67.7% magenta, 75% yellow and 24.7% black. It has a hue angle of 5.8 degrees, a saturation of 60% and a lightness of 47.1%. #c03e30 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ff7c60 with #810000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

#c03e30 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c03e30 has RGB values of R:192, G:62, B:48 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.68, Y:0.75,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 12598832.
